Albert Leonard Johnson (February 14, 1894 —March 11, 1960) is a veteran associated with Chautauqua County, New York. Johnson served during World War I and later operated a jewelry store in Jamestown, NY.
Biography
Albert Johnson was born on February 14, 1894 in Houtzdale, Pennsylvania to August and Johanna Johnson.
He served during World War I and was wounded in action.
